Tasting Notes: The aroma of rice and koji spreads the moment you drink it, and it feels dry on first sip. Then a gradual sweetness wraps the tongue softy and slowly disappears. Only slightly sweet with rich aroma and a creamy taste of rice. This sake is uniquely dryer for a Nigori, and light with the dregs.
From The Brewery: Iwamura Brewery was founded in 1787, and only brews Premium Classifications of sake in the world’s pickiest sake country – Japan. Iwamura uses natural mineral water that springs from a four hundred year-old spring deep in the secluded mountainous environment of Gifu Prefecture.
ABV: 17%
Type : Nigori Tokubetsu Honjozo 720mlRice Grain : Hidahomare
S.M.V. –4
Milling Level : 60%,
